Assertion (A): In humans, if gene b gives blue eyes and gene B gives brown eyes, then the colour of the eyes of a person having Bb combination of genes will be blue.

Reason (R): The recessive gene cannot show its effect in the presence of dominant gene.

विकल्प

  • Both A and R are true and R is correct explanation of the assertion.

  • Both A and R are true but R is not the correct explanation of the assertion.

  • A is true but R is false.

  • A is false but R is true.

उत्तर

A is false but R is true.

Explanation:

In this case, B is the dominant gene for brown eyes, while b is the recessive gene for blue eyes. A person with the genotype Bb will have brown eyes because the dominant allele B masks the effect of the recessive allele b. Therefore, Assertion (A) is false.

A recessive gene cannot express its trait in the presence of a dominant gene because its effect is masked by the dominant allele. Therefore, Reason (R) is true.

Hence, A is false but R is true.
